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ad Ingredients

For the Salad

  • Cottage Cheese – Provides a smooth, creamy texture and mild flavor. Can substitute with ricotta cheese or Greek yogurt.
  • Canned Tuna – Adds a hearty, firm texture and savory depth. Use either canned or freshly cooked tuna as preferred.
  • Mayonnaise – Adds creaminess and binds the salad together. Dijon mustard can be used for a tangier flavor if desired.
  • Celery – Contributes a refreshing crunch and mild flavor that contrasts with the creaminess. Chop finely for best texture.
  • Red Onion – Provides a sharp, slightly sweet flavor. Can be swapped with green onions for a milder taste.
  • Lemon Juice – Brightens the salad with its acidity. Add more for a zesty kick as you prefer.
  • Salt & Black Pepper – Enhances the overall flavors of the salad. Adjust seasoning to taste.

Optional Add-Ins

  • Diced Bell Peppers – For added nutrition and sweetness. A colorful boost that also adds crunch!
  • Hot Sauce or Chili Flakes – For a spicy kick. Transform your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ad into a fiery delight!
  • Shredded Carrots – Introduces a hint of natural sweetness and a vibrant color. Great for extra crunch and nutrition!

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ad

Step 1: Prepare the Tuna
Begin by opening a can of tuna and draining any excess liquid. Use a fork to flake the tuna into a medium-sized mixing bowl. Ensure that the tuna appears chunky but evenly broken up, promoting a delightful texture in your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ad.

Step 2: Mix in the Cottage Cheese
Add a generous scoop of cottage cheese to the flaked tuna. Gently fold the two together using a spatula or spoon until the mixture is well combined, ensuring the creamy cottage cheese coats the tuna beautifully. This combination should look rich and luscious, setting the stage for a scrumptious salad.

Step 3: Chop Fresh Vegetables
Next, finely chop the celery and red onion. The celery should have a consistent, small dice to add a nice crunch, while the red onion contributes a vibrant color and flavor. Incorporate these freshly chopped vegetables into the tuna and cottage cheese mixture, stirring well to distribute them evenly throughout the salad.

Step 4: Add Flavor Enhancers
Squeeze fresh lemon juice over the salad for brightness, and get ready to add a dollop of mayonnaise for extra creaminess. If you prefer a sharper taste, mix in a spoonful of Dijon mustard at this stage. Stir these ingredients in until they are evenly mixed and charmingly creamy, elevating the flavors of your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ad.

Step 5: Season to Perfection
Sprinkle salt and freshly ground black pepper into your salad, adjusting to your taste preference. This seasoning is key to enhancing the overall flavors. Mix everything once again until well combined, watching as the hues brighten and the textures meld beautifully.

Step 6: Chill Before Serving
To deepen the flavors, cover the bowl with plastic wrap or a lid and chill the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This waiting period allows the ingredients to harmonize perfectly, making each serving a refreshing and delightful experience.

Step 7: Serve and Enjoy
After chilling, give the salad a gentle stir and taste for any final seasoning adjustments. Serve it on a bed of greens, between slices of toasted bread, or with crunchy crackers for a delightful meal or snack. Enjoy the vibrant flavors and creamy textures of your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ad!

How to Store and Freeze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ad

  • Fridge: Store the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ad in an airtight container for up to 2-3 days. For best flavor and texture, avoid mixing in lemon juice or mustard until ready to serve.

  • Freezer: While freezing is not recommended due to the texture changes of the cottage cheese, if needed, it can last up to 1 month. Just remember that it may become watery when thawed.

  • Reheating: This salad is best enjoyed cold. If you prefer a warm dish, consider using the tuna and cottage cheese mix in warm dishes instead of reheating the salad itself.

Make Ahead Options

These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ad preps are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time without sacrificing flavor! You can mix the cottage cheese, tuna, and chopped vegetables up to 24 hours in advance. To maintain the salad’s freshness,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ator, but hold off on adding the lemon juice and mayonnaise until just before serving. This prevents sogginess and keeps textures intact. When you’re ready to enjoy your salad, simply stir in the reserved ingredients, adjust the seasoning, and you’ll have a delicious, protein-packed meal that tastes just as delightful as if you made it fresh!

Ingredients
  

For the Salad
  • 1 cup Cottage Cheese Can substitute with ricotta cheese or Greek yogurt.
  • 1 can Canned Tuna Use either canned or freshly cooked tuna as preferred.
  • 2 tablespoons Mayonnaise Dijon mustard can be used for a tangier flavor if desired.
  • 1 stalk Celery Chop finely for best texture.
  • 1/4 cup Red Onion Can be swapped with green onions for a milder taste.
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on Juice Add more for a zesty kick as you prefer.
  • to taste Salt & Black Pepper Adjust seasoning to taste.
Optional Add-Ins
  • 1/2 cup Diced Bell Peppers A colorful boost that also adds crunch!
  • to taste Hot Sauce or Chili Flakes Transform your Cottage Cheese Tuna Salad into a fiery delight!
  • 1/2 cup Shredded Carrots Great for extra crunch and nutrition!

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• Spatula
  • Knife
  • Cutting board

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Begin by opening a can of tuna and draining any excess liquid. Use a fork to flake the tuna into a medium-sized mixing bowl.
  2. Add a generous scoop of cottage cheese to the flaked tuna. Gently fold the two together until the mixture is well combined.
  3. Finely chop the celery and red onion. Incorporate these freshly chopped vegetables into the tuna and cottage cheese mixture, stirring well.
  4. Squeeze fresh lemon juice over the salad and add a dollop of mayonnaise for extra creaminess. Stir these ingredients in until well mixed.
  5. Sprinkle salt and pepper into your salad, adjusting to your taste preference. Mix again until well combined.
  6.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or a lid and ch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es.
  7. Serve on a bed of greens, between slices of toasted bread, or with crunchy crackers.
